Intragastric Balloons Intra gastric balloons are safe and reversible methods of non-surgical weight loss. These patients already have undergone considerable changes in diet and lifestyle, and these balloons provide further assistance. BMI patients greater than 30 may benefit from the use of gastric balloons. These balloons are reasonably positioned. The Orbera® Intragastric Balloon does not require complex surgeries and can be considered a non-invasive weight loss treatment. The Orbera®, a device implanted in the stomach through an endoscopic procedure, is a silicone balloon that goes in the stomach. In a saline solution a sterile blanket is tinted, filled up to the dimensions of a grapefruit. The period of implant is max half a year, there is less discomfort during eating as a balloon in the upper part of the stomach reduces its effective volume. After twelve weeks with the gastric balloon the proportion of stomach volume is restricted to 60-70 percent, possible average percentage weight loss with the gastric balloon is ten percent among treated subjects. The implantable balloon option is not for chronic overeaters.
